Report: John Edwards Charges U.S $55,000 for Speech on Poverty

John Edwards has an example to teach University of California at Davis students how to avoid poverty — charge U.S $55,000 for a speech. That's how much the 2008 Democratic presidential candidate negotiated for his fee to speak to 1,787 people at the taxpayer-funded school in January 2006, according to financial disclosures.
